About Fate/Grand Order: Moonlight/Lostroom (2017) — A Surreal 32-Minute Fantasy Adventure
Dive into the mysterious heart of *Fate/Grand Order: Moonlight/Lostroom* (2017), a 32-minute animated fantasy adventure directed by Takuro Tsukada. This short film follows the enigmatic Lostroom, a surreal sanctuary nestled within Chaldea's digital realm where the moon's glow blurs the line between dreams and reality. Here, time bends and fragments of what was—and what could be—linger as fleeting echoes, offering glimpses of lost treasures and future regrets. The story unfolds through sharp action sequences and a dreamlike atmosphere, weaving fantasy with philosophical musings about memory and fate.
Starring the talented voice cast of Nobunaga Shimazaki, Rie Takahashi, and Tomokazu Sugita, the short film delivers high-energy animation and captivating performances. As a *Fate/Grand Order* spin-off, *Moonlight/Lostroom* stands out as a visually stunning exploration of loss and longing, wrapped in the franchise's signature blend of mythology and science fiction.
